I think its very hard to make a lot of positives or negatives out of your players facing eachother. Because if its a tough battle it could be both are great or both suck, and if one dominates it could be one is great, or the other is just lousy. Its much more useful to see how your players perform relative to other teams. If a few players really stand out in camp, you can keep an eye on those players, and if they are rookies that can be good. But it could also just mean your rookies are schooling your vets because you have an old team coming off a 9-8 record that would have been 7-10 or worse against a decent schedule.

For the same reason that I do not own a waterford crystal salad bowl. Because its expensive glass.

Sometimes signing a high injury risk veteran can be ok if you get a big enough discount, but you should not move a young healthy player to a new position to make room, because you will likely just be moving them back and throw off their development.
